Suspects In Fatal Shooting Arrested On Unrelated Robbery

NEW YORK (CBS 2/AP) -- Three teenagers wanted in connection with the fatal shooting of a woman who was trying to keep muggers from taking her cell phone full of her husband's romantic texts were nabbed after they were arrested on an unrelated robbery.

Police said Sunday two of the suspects, Corey Brown and Ian Green, both 17, were arrested on murder charges in the death of 23-year-old Rabia Mohammed, of Queens. A third suspect, 16-year-old Tiyquon Hodges, was arrested on robbery charges. The names of their lawyers were not immediately available.

Police say the three were busted for an unrelated robbery on March 17. Police did not provide details on that crime.

Mohammed was shot while walking with her husband in Queens last Sunday. Shazam Khan said his wife likely put up a fight because she cherished the texts on her phone.
